anti lift plates will give you more grip, and bigger wheels with a wider tread will help too. 16/45/205 is what I have, and with the anti lift plates I get a hella lot more traction, and smoother acceleration too. anti-lift made the biggest difference, maybe worth looking into if you're tight on money. I was going to get a LSD but don't really need it now I don't think.
